The glass is half-empty over at the Post lately. Jason La Canfora’s article in the Post today essentially says the same thing an article from Redskins.com said a few days ago. That is that Jason Campbell will play on Thursday if he’s healthy. But these were the headlines:
Post- Campbell Says He’s Willing, but Is His Knee Able?
Redskins.com- Campbell Says He’s Ready to Play
What’s up with all the gloom, Post? Both articles quote Coach Gibbs saying Campbell will only play if he’s 100%. Both articles quote Campbell saying the knee is still sore. Both quote Campbell talking about how important it is to establish a rhythm with the receivers before the season starts.
And the Post articles includes this little tidbit: “When told of Gibbs’s remarks Campbell said, “Oh, I’ll be 100 percent by Thursday.”
In other words, Campbell is chomping at the bit to play and is willing to play through a bit of pain. that’s great. Stop worrying, Post. He’ll be fine.
Bet on Campbell to play on Thursday, but if he doesn’t, don’t take it as a sign of anything but erring on the side of caution. Campbell is ready to go right now, and if the regular season was starting today, you can bet he’d be out there.
